从骨科医生到诺贝尔奖——山中伸弥的研究历程

摘要 山中伸弥(ShinyaYamanaka)获得诺奖已经有近一年了,虽然三年前在听完他的讲座后我兴致很高地写了两篇博客,这些天我却没有多少动力再写一篇完整的文章来介绍他的工作。我一直对中国现在还盛行的规划性科研,应用导向型科研耿耿于怀。这些所谓的重大项目在立项的当初对目标/前景写得宏大无比,之后却通常草草收场。
